Purva Heritage is a single-tower apartment project by Puravankara at Hongasandra village, off Hosur Road near Kudlu Gate, South-East Bangalore. It’s a small, high-density boutique tower rather than a township, positioned squarely on its metro connectivity.
Location & Connectivity
The site is at Hongasandra Village, Begur Hobli, Bengaluru South – 560068, close to Garvebhavi Palya on Hosur Main Road. The standout feature here is proximity to the Kudlu Gate metro station on the Yellow Line, cited at anywhere from 180 m to about 400 m from different sources — either way, this is a genuinely walkable metro location once the Yellow Line is operational, which is unusual for a project at this price point in this corridor. It also sits within easy reach of Electronic City and HSR Layout.
Project Specifications
The project occupies a tight 1.7-acre plot with a single tower of ground + 20 floors, housing 145-148 apartments depending on the source (a small, likely rounding-level discrepancy). Two configurations are on offer: 2 BHK units around 1,300 sq ft and 3 BHK units around 1,900 sq ft. RERA number is PRM/KA/RERA/1251/310/PR/090726/008801, registered 9 July 2026 — a very recent launch, with pre-launch EOIs opening a couple of weeks earlier on 25 June 2026. Possession is targeted for September 2030.
Pricing
Listed pricing runs from about Rs 1.92 crore to Rs 3.65 crore across the two configurations, worked out at roughly Rs 16,000 per sq ft. One source quotes a starting price closer to Rs 2.10 crore — likely reflecting a slightly later price list after early pre-launch EOI pricing, which is common as projects move from EOI to formal launch. Treat the lower end as an early-bird figure that may no longer be on offer.
Amenities
Given the compact footprint, Puravankara has leaned into vertical amenity design: a roughly 17,000 sq ft clubhouse with an infinity pool, described as offering 20+ facilities, tri-deck balconies with wide-angle views, and the project is marketed around “76% open space” — a figure that on a 1.7-acre single-tower plot should be read as landscaped/podium open area rather than ground-level green cover in the way you’d expect from a larger township.

A Few Honest Notes
A single G+20 tower on 1.7 acres means very high density for the plot size, and buyers should go in expecting a vertical, amenity-light-on-ground-space living experience compared to Puravankara’s larger township projects. The metro proximity is a genuine differentiator for this micro-market, but it’s worth checking the Yellow Line’s actual operational status and frequency before weighting that heavily in your decision, since under-construction metro lines in Bangalore have a long history of slipping timelines.
